Patch Picks: Restaurant Week

Orange County's Restaurant Week offers deals on meals around the county.

This week's Patch Picks shines a spotlight on Orange County's Restaurant Week, which runs from Feb. 27 to March 5. While Lake Forest eateries don't have much of a presence on the list of participants, the surrounding areas boast of restaurants with incredible menus and deals to satisfy any hunger craving.

Check out our list of just a few restaurants in this installment of Patch Picks. 

Crystal Jade Asian Fine Dining
Where: 
6511 Quail Hill, Irvine
Why Go: Black pepper beef tenderloin and honey walnut shrimp are a small sample of the menu.
Pricing: $10 lunch, $20, $30 or $40 dinner

Lucca Cafe
Where: 
6507 Quail Hill Pkwy., Irvine
Why Go: Complimentary iced tea or soft drinks with $15 lunch menu purchase.
Pricing: $15 lunch, $30 dinner

Nirvana Grille Restaurant & Catering
Where:
 24031 Marguerite Pkwy., Unit C, Mission Viejo
Why Go: Selections include organic cauliflower and goat cheese gratin, butternut squash and portobello mushroom risotto and cedar plank Scottish salmon.
Pricing: $30 and $40 three-course dinners

Simply Fondue
Where: 
28719 Los Alisos Blvd., Mission Viejo
Why Go: Choose from four cooking styles: traditional, Mediterranean sangria, vegetable bouillon and fondue grill.
Pricing: $20 three-course dinner
